Beyond the Dream: Martin Luther King Jr.'s Persistent Message
Martin Luther King Jr.'s dream was a vision of racial harmony and equality. It galvanized a nation and inspired countless individuals to fight for justice. Yet, beyond this powerful imagery, lies an enduring message that resonates even deeper today. King's philosophy transcended the immediate struggle against segregation; it promoted a universal call for human dignity and social responsibility. He challenged us to confront not only overt prejudice but also the insidious structures of inequality embedded in our society.
In a world grappling with persistent disparities, King's message remains vitally relevant. His commitment to nonviolent resistance offers a powerful example of how change can be realized through peaceful means. His copyright continue to inspire us to work for a more just and equitable world, reminding us that the journey towardsunity is an ongoing process that demands constant vigilance and unwavering commitment.

The Strength of Nonviolent Action: Learning from Martin Luther King Jr.
Martin Luther King Jr.'s unwavering belief in nonviolent resistance serves as a timeless inspiration. His guidance during the Civil Rights demonstrated the profound impact of peaceful demonstrations in bringing about real social change. King understood that love and empathy are powerful means against injustice, capable of transforming hearts and minds. By embracing nonviolent methods, he challenged systemic racism and inspired a generation to fight for equality.
- King's message continue to resonate within humanity around the world, reminding us of the efficacy of nonviolent action in resolving societal challenges.
- His impact serves as a beacon of hope, demonstrating that even in the face of resistance, love and nonviolence can prevail.
